Express the ratio below in its simplest form 3:6:6

Mathematics
1 answer:
matrenka [14]3 years ago
3 0

Answer:

1:2:2

Step-by-step explanation:

To simplify this ratio, you need to find a common factor to divide by. In this instance, that would be 3.
